On CNBC's "Options Action," Mike Khouw shared with the viewers his way to trade Uber Technologies Inc UBER ahead of earnings. Uber reports on August 6 and the options market is implying a move of around 9% in either direction.
Khouw finds it extraordinary that the stock is trading higher on the year in spite of the impact of COVID-19 on its business. Uber also has other issues, like big negative cash flow and anti-trust concerns.
Khouw has a Neutral to Bearish view on the stock so he wants to sell the August $30.50 call and buy the August $31.50 call for a total credit of 40 cents.
If the stock stays below $30.90 at the August 21 expiration, Khouw is expected to collect the premium, which is his maximal profit. He can at most lose 60 cents per share with this trade.
